World War II Memorial - Beaufort

Where? rue de l'église, L-6315 Beaufort

The memorial stone commemorates those who went missing or were killed during the Second World War

The memorial stone with the inscription ‘Aux victimes de la guerre 1940-1945’ – “To the victims of the war between 1940 and 1945” is intended to commemorate the residents of Beaufort who went missing or were killed during the World War II.

Below the memorial stone is another stone with a cross on it.

The memorial site is located right beside the church.
